The "Kagurado" in the title refers to a mythical land or state of being—part heaven, part forgotten history—that calls to the old hero. The journey is linear but dense with character interactions that feel more like philosophical debates than standard RPG dialogue. The game asks difficult questions: What is the value of a warrior without a war? Does strength have an expiration date? And is it better to burn out in a blaze of glory or rust away in silence?
